Abstract

Poly(1,8-diaminocarbazole) (PDACz) films on the Pt electrodes were obtained from acetonitrile (0.1 M LiClO4) and acidic aqueous solutions (0.1 M HClO4). The changes in the shape of polymerization curves in the two media are discussed in terms of a limited conductivity window of the fully oxidized PDACz. The polymer structure of the films obtained from acetonitrile and acidic aqueous solution was proposed on the base of FTIR spectra and the results of theoretical calculations. Density functional theory (DFT) was used to calculate a distribution of unpaired-electron spin density for monomer radical cations to predict the coupling positions during polymerization. This method allowed to resolve the problems concerning the monomer linkage, still present after analysis of FTIR spectra of the polymer.
